Analysis

The most recent figure for tea leaves — producer price in Mozambique is 61,430 SLC, measured in 2003.

The figure is down 0.6% on the previous year and up 514.3% over ten years.

That places Mozambique 11th out of 21 countries with data for 2003, putting it in the middle of the range.

Tea leaves — Producer Price in Mozambique, year by year

Annual values for Tea leaves — Producer Price (SLC/tonne) in Mozambique, 1997 to 2003.
Year SLC Change
1997 10,000 SLC
1998 10,000 SLC +0.0%
1999 61,580 SLC +515.8%
2000 60,830 SLC -1.2%
2001 63,460 SLC +4.3%
2002 61,780 SLC -2.6%
2003 61,430 SLC -0.6%

This sub-domain contains data on agriculture producer prices and the producer price index. Agriculture producer prices are prices received by farmers for primary crops, live animals and livestock primary products as collected at the point of initial sale (prices paid at the farm gate). Annual data are provided from 1991 (while mothly data start in January 2010) for 180 countries and 212 products. The producer price index is the index of agricultural producer prices that measures the average annual change over time in the selling prices received by farmers (prices at the farm gate or at the first point of sale). The three categories of producer price index available in FAOSTAT comprise: single-item price index, commodity group index and the agriculture producer price index.
